W dniu 19.03.2019, wto o godzinie 12∶56 +0100, użytkownik Tomasz Chiliński napisał:
W dniu 19.03.2019 11:53, Sylwester Zdanowski napisał(a):
Witam,
Cześć,
Witam,
Trafiłem na ciekawostkę.
Jeżeli ustawię termin ostateczny bez weryfikatora potem przy dodawaniu nowej wiadomości próbuję ustawić weryfikatora wyrzuca błąd "Jeżeli weryfikator jest ustawiony, jest on jedyna osobą która może zmienić termin ostateczny" Jednocześnie znika nagłówek strony "Nowa wiadomość". Weryfikatora można ustawić przez edycję zgłoszenia.
Teraz mając Termin ostateczny na 2019/03/31 11:35 i Weryfikatora na innego usera lms nie mogę dodać wiadomości bez wyświetlenia żadnego błędu.
zrobiłem print_r($error) Array ( [deadline] => Jeśli weryfikator jest ustawiony, jest on jedyną osobą, która może zmienić termin ostateczny! )
chociaż terminu nie da się w tym momęcie edytować...
Przeoczyłem jedną rzecz: https://github.com/lmsgit/lms/commit/a580125395b16cc9ab2f62eb45e1dd2a 715367c0 Nadal nie waliduje to zmiany weryfikatora i terminu ostatecznego dla wiadomości grupowej (brak walidacji), ale przynajmniej powinno działać dla pojedynczej wiadomości. Sprawdzisz teraz?
W tej chwili nie widzę żadnego problemu.
W dniu 19.03.2019, wto o godzinie 08∶41 +0100, użytkownik Tomasz Chiliński napisał:
W dniu 16.03.2019 11:28, Sylwester Zdanowski napisał(a):
Witam,
Witam,
Być może nie widzę koncepcji autora.
Mam zgłoszenie z polem "Werfikator: żaden" Jak dodaje nową wiadomość dostaję "If verifier is set then he's the only person who can change deadline" (Jeżeli WERYFIKATOR JEST USTAWIONY....)
W rtmessageadd mamy w lini 74 ... && $message['verifierid'] != Auth::GetCurrentUser())
w praktyce bez ustawionego weryfikatora i bez phpui.helpdesk_allow_all_users_modify_deadline nie da się dodać wiadomości.
(Przy dodawaniu nowego zgłoszenia pole terminu ostatecznego automatycznie ustawia się na czas bieżący)
Pytanie czy powinien być dodatkowy warunek dla braku weryfikatora czy bez weryfikatora ma być nie możliwe dodanie wiadomości o ile ktoś nie ustawi konfiguracji? Jaka była koncepcja?
Możesz sprawdzić czy bieżąca wersja kodu rozwiązuje problem?
lms mailing list lms@lists.lms.org.pl http://lists.lms.org.pl/mailman/listinfo/lms